Dot Mil Docs: Military Social Work

Next time on Dot Mil Docs:

Dr. Jose E. Coll, director of the Military Social Work program at the University of Southern California, and Marine Corps veteran, will discuss this developing program for military social work and veteran services. The program is designed to train social workers and other mental health professionals to help service members, veterans and their families manage the pressures of military life.
